StrStrategic cost control

Describe how you would manage cost control through the life
cycle of a project. Indicate how the techniques are linked.
Cost Outline strategyamme

Pre-Brief – business case/ mandate


Brief Stage - use superficial or unit rates/feasibility study
Sketch Plan - Develop elemental plan
Approval Stage - full elemental plan
Production Drawing - cost checking/BoQ
Tender reconciliation - check pricing assumptions –
BoQ/Time schedule
Construction Stage – monitor BoQ/PERT
Post Completion - reconciliation, data gathering
